FLUID SIMULATION PROGRAM, FLUID SIMULATION METHOD AND FLUID SIMULATION DEVICE

PROBLEM TO BE SOLVED: To provide a fluid simulation program, a fluid simulation method and a fluid simulation device with which it is possible to secure the convergence of solutions in a particle method.;SOLUTION: The fluid simulation program causes an extracting process, a finding process and a calculating process to be executed by a computer. The extracting process extracts, on the basis of position information included in the particle data of each particle at a prescribed time, a particle whose distance from a first particle is less than or equal to a prescribed value as a second particle from among wall boundary particles on the boundary with a wall, the first particle being the one whose distance from a fluid particle is less than or equal to a prescribed value. The finding process sets, on the basis of the extracted first and second particles, the boundary condition of a pressure Poisson equation that finds the pressure of each particle and finds the pressure acting on each particle. The calculating process calculates the particle data of each particle at the next time on the basis of the found pressure.;SELECTED DRAWING: Figure 4;COPYRIGHT: (C)2019,JPO&INPIT
